Context Sirach 44…20Abraham was the great father of a multitude of nations, and there was not found the like to him in glory, who kept the law of the most High, and was in covenant with him. 21In his flesh he established the covenant, and in temptation he was found faithful. 22Therefore by an oath he gave him glory in his posterity, that he should increase as the dust of the earth,… |
